HOW DO I GET THERE?
BY VEHICLE: Moab is located in the Southeast desert of Utah along Hwy 191. You can get to Hwy 191 via the north route of Interstate-70, via the south route through AZ or NM, or along many other scenic byways and highways. Carpooling is encouraged!
BY PLANE: The 3 closest airports are, respectively: Canyonlands Field Airport (20 min drive), Grand Junction Regional Airport (~2 hours drive) and Salt Lake City International Airport (~4 hours drive). Arrival times vary by airport, with limited flights in/out of Canyonlands Field Airport. There are car rental companies at all airports as well as shuttle services to/from Moab.
